Find resources from the Place and Wellbeing Alliance online event which took place on 22 May 2025.

This online seminar considered ‘Housing’ from the perspective of Health & Wellbeing, the impact on individuals, communities, and the ability of Scotland to flourish as a nation. Also studying the current housing stock, future development options, affordability, infrastructure, and connectivity.
